Angle-of-Arrival Estimation in Multipath Environments Using Sliding Antenna Arrays

By Mirel Ciprian Paun, Razvan Tamas, and Ion Marghescu
Progress In Electromagnetics Research Letters, Vol. 54, 101-105, 2015
doi:10.2528/PIERL15062307

Abstract

This paper presents a method for improving Angle-of-Arrival estimation accuracy in multipath environments using a sliding antenna array consisting of only two antennas. The proposed method is then experimentally validated by means of a dual channel Software-Defined Radio receiver and a wireless microphone.
